
Inside Active by Bloomberg Intelligence TCW’s Horton on Transforming Legacy Industries
Oct 28, 2025
Eli Horton, Managing Director of Equities at TCW and senior portfolio manager for the TCW Transform Systems ETF, breaks down systems-based investing and its relevance to energy and industrial transformations. He argues that changing legacy industries is vital for future growth and highlights investment opportunities in power supply bottlenecks. Horton discusses the promise of decentralized energy systems, the importance of recognizing brown-to-green shifts in legacy companies, and the need for a disciplined approach to valuation amidst increasing demand for electricity.

Think In Systems Not Sectors
- The economy should be viewed as interconnected systems rather than isolated sectors.
- Transforming energy, grid, materials and industrials requires coordinated changes across many sectors.
Concentrated 20–30 Stock Portfolio
- The TCW Transform Systems ETF holds 20–30 stocks to balance focus and diversification.
- Eli says concentration enables them to maximize capital in their best ideas and outperform over cycles.
Adapt When Facts Change
- When facts change, change your mind and adapt your portfolio.
- Re-underwrite investments regularly and shift capital toward better risk-adjusted ideas.
